Overall Responsibility:
The officer will be responsible for leading, coordinating, and executing high-impact, multidisciplinary research initiatives that align with the institute’s strategic objectives.
Generic Tasks and Responsibilities: The Generic tasks of the successful candidate will be to:
- Designing and implementing innovative and integrated research projects, experiments and studies based on thematic multi-disciplinary and cross-functional teams.
- Developing grant proposals to secure funding for conducting specific research programs in line with the Institute’s strategic management plan.
- Identifying sources of funding, mobilizing resources and developing proposals for competitive funding especially those that enhance linkages and partnerships.
- Publishing and disseminating scientific research findings in peer reviewed journals, books etc.
- Providing technical leadership, mentorship, supervision and consultation to team members, research officers, professional co-workers, collaborators, students and others attached to the organization.
Required Qualification and Experience:
Mandatory criteria: Applicants must meet the following five criteria.
- Should possess a PhD with the exception of staff in the Engineering Discipline who possess a master’s degree.
- Should have served as Senior Research Officer for at least five (5) years.
- Should with evidence have contributed towards development of at least five research development proposals in the last five years totaling to One Million United States Dollars (US $ 1,000,000).
- Should with evidence have participated in high caliber research resulting in the development of patented, licensed, and/or commercialized new products. This shall be evidenced by a patent, license, and/or registration number, or by any other defendable means.
- Should with evidence have conducted high caliber research and published as first author and/or co-author of at least four articles of which two should be in high impact journals (impact factor > 1.5) in the past five years.
Optional criteria: Applicants must meet any four of the following criteria.
- Should have published a book chapter. This shall be evidenced by ISBN, ISSN numbers.
- Should with evidence, in the past five years, have successfully supervised three post-graduate students.
- Should, with evidence, have been appointed to examine at least two post-graduate theses as “Internal/External Examiner” or “Opponent” in the past five years.
- Should, with evidence, have served as a reviewer for at least two peer reviewed Journals and/or grant award scheme.
- Should have served as a Principal Investigator (PI), Co-PI, or Team Member on an international and/or regional project.
- Should with evidence have directly mentored and/or supervised at least five staff of low ranks in the past five years.
- Should with evidence have caused diffusion /permeation of at least a technology causing reputable impact on livelihoods and economic development in a community.
